Molecular Dynamics (MD) is employed to investigate nonthermal melting triggered by coherent phonon excitation in bismuth telluride, which has Peierls distortion in the lattice structure. Results showed that the structural distortion caused by coherent phonons appears as early as 80 fs, while it takes several picoseconds for the whole phononexcited area to evolve into a liquid state. First-order phase transitions are characterized by a discontinuous first derivative of the Gibbs free energy, so that volumes and entropies are discontinuous. Such transitions are common in the crystalline state, but extremely rare in liquid substances and experimentally evidenced in only one pure element, phosphorus. We demonstrate liquid-metal-mediated homoepitaxial crystal growth of Ge on Ge( 111) at temperatures in the range of 400-450 “C. Crystal growth proceeds by diffusion of Ge through a liquid layer, followed by precipitation onto the substrate by the vapor-liquid-solid mechanism. The objective of this paper is to investigate water supercooling. Supercooling occurs when a liquid does not freeze although its temperature is below its freezing point. In general, supercooling is an unstable condition and occurs under special conditions.
